The TESOL Unconference Summary
On December 14-15, 2023, Tan Tao University hosted a TESOL Unconference sponsored by the US Department of State’s 2023 Alumni Engagement Innovation Fund (AEIF). The participant-driven event brought together more than 120 English educators from many higher education institutions in the Mekong Delta provinces and in Ho Chi Minh City. At the Unconference, the attendees tackled a variety of topics relevant to both current and future teaching contexts, including Technology Integration, Classroom Activities and Techniques, Classroom Motivation, Classroom Management, Teaching English for Specific Purposes and Standardized Tests, and Cultural Sensitivity and Global Citizenship. The event also discussed ways to organize an Unconference effectively so that the participants can replicate the model at their respective teaching affiliates. After the two-day Unconference, the participants left the event with renewed enthusiasm and armed with fresh and practical ideas in English instruction. The event also fostered a strengthened network of colleagues across universities in Mekong Delta and in Ho Chi Minh City, igniting a shared commitment to collaboration, growth, and innovation for “Transforming English Education Together”.
